“Curse Castle”

"Curse Castle" delivers a chilling tale from Black Cat Comics #40 (1952), a 10-cent gem where a desperate man's fury against the sun ignites a supernatural reckoning. When a jungle wanderer curses the blazing sky, a witchdoctor's dark retaliation sends him to endure eternal torment at the hands of Soltan the Sun King. Rendered in bold, expressive lines by Rudy Palais—both penciling and inking the interior and crafting the cover—this eerie story blends primal dread with early comic book mysticism.

Full plot ⚠ may contain spoilers

▸ Reveal full plot — may contain spoilers

A man suffering through intense heat out in the jungle curses the sun. The local witchdoctor curses him and he is sent to the sun to suffer at the hands of Soltan the Sun King.
